## What it is
Project Flogo is an ultra-light, Go-based open source ecosystem for building event-driven applications using triggers and actions. It supports application integration flows, stream processing, a rules engine, and native TensorFlow inferencing, deployable as serverless functions, containers, or static binaries on edge devices.

## Use cases
- build lightweight serverless functions in Go
- process IoT edge events with sub-10MB binaries
- run stream processing pipelines on Kafka or MQTT events
- integrate APIs, databases, and apps with event-driven flows
- run TensorFlow model inferencing at the edge
- deploy event-driven microservices as containers or static binaries
- implement business rules that react to incoming events

## When to choose
- you need ultra-lightweight event-driven apps for edge or serverless deployment
- you want a Go-based alternative to heavier Java/Node integration engines
- you need to combine integration flows, streaming, rules, and ML inferencing in one binary
- you consume events from MQTT, Kafka, or other triggers

## When to avoid
- you need a general-purpose web framework with rich HTTP routing
- you prefer a large ecosystem of third-party libraries over a contribution model
- you need heavy GUI-based enterprise integration tooling beyond Flogo's web designer
- your team is not comfortable with Go
